Villa del Cerro

, Also briefly called Villa del Cerro Cerro, is a neighborhood ( barrio ) of the Uruguayan capital, Montevideo.

Location and geography

It is located northwest of the city center, the old town opposite the bay of Montevideo in the south of the department of Montevideo. Villa del Cerro borders it to the south and south-east by the Rio de la Plata. To the west lies the district Casabo - Pajas Blancas while connecting to the north of La Paloma - Tomkinson and Tres Ombúes Pueblo Victoria. In the northeast, La Teja continues the urban area. Sports

Villa del Cerro home to two football clubs Cerro and Rampla Juniors. Here guests will find the Estadio Olímpico in the Rampla Juniors unsubscribe their home games.

Attractions

On the Cerro de Montevideo, the Fortaleza General Artigas rises. Furthermore, at the Barrio are the Plaza de los Immigrantes and the cemetery Cementerio del Cerro.
